MASTER (VOLUME) CONTROL

The Master (meaning "Master Volume") control adjusts the level being sent to the power amplifier in your Workingman's 2x10C

− it

controls the overall volume of the unit. Turning the control counter-clockwise reduces the overall level, while turning the control clock-
wise boosts the overall level.

Two notes: The Master control never affects the level present at the XLR or effects send jacks

− it only affects the level being sent to

the power amplifier, and subsequently, your internal speaker system and extension speaker output only. Also, losses caused by out-
board effects units can be recovered by increasing the Master control.

SPEAKERS ON/OFF SWITCH

This two-position switch controls the signal sent from the power amplifier to the speaker section of your Workingman's 2x10C and an
extension speaker if connected (hence the term "speakers"). When set to the On (top) position (default setting from the factory), the
Workingman's 2x10C will operate normally, and the sound of your amplified bass will be heard from the speaker section and any con-
nected extension speaker. When set to the Speakers (bottom) position, that signal will be defeated regardless of the settings on the
front panel. This can be useful for silent practicing (in conjunction with the Headphones Jack, listed below), or for defeating the audio
while you re-patch cables or plug and unplug your instrument. This switch will not affect the signal present at the various audio out-
puts (XLR, Effects Send, Tuner Out). It will also not affect the signal present at the Headphone Jack.

NOTE: If the volume on your instrument is up, and your Gain and Master Volume controls are up, and especially if you're seeing

the Preamp Clip and Limiter Active LED's illuminate while you're playing… and you can't understand why you're not getting any audible
output from the Workingman's 2x10C, check the position of this switch!

HEADPHONES JACK (stereo only)

By inserting a set of stereo headphones into this jack, you can monitor your sound more closely in a studio situation, or practice
silently (when the Speakers On/Off Switch is set to "Off") so as not to completely annoy your neighbors. The headphone volume level
is adjusted by the Master Volume. We suggest you begin with the Master Volume full off (counter-clockwise), then slowly bring up the
volume to the desired level. If you hear some distortion in your headphones that isn't present through your speaker system, turn
down the Master Volume. You are probably overdriving your headphones and could ruin them, to say nothing of what you may be
doing to your ears.

Any impedance headphones will work. However, optimum impedance is 75 ohms.

POWER ON/OFF SWITCH

This switch turns the complete unit on or off. Setting the switch upwards to the "On" position turns on the unit, and the switch itself
will illuminate in red. Setting the switch downward to the "Power" position will turn the unit off, and the red light inside the power
switch will turn off as well.
